Technicals for ITI Limited
Price Summary
With a 3.74% rise, ITI Limited enjoyed a stellar day in the stock market.On 2026-03-02, ITI's stock began at 251.1, peaked at 267.0, dipped to 251.1, and closed up 3.74% at 260.5, with a volume of 379240 shares.
In the 52-week period, the stock's peak price is 364.85, and the lowest price recorded is 234.04.
Technicals
Aroon: The persistent bearish trend in Aroon, with Aroon Down consistently at the 100 level, signals continued downward pressure. To gain a complete understanding of this trend, it should be explored further in conjunction with other technical indicators.
Bol. Bands: The price has dropped below the lower Bollinger Band and has stayed there since the last move, indicating strong bearish momentum. This prolonged position below the band suggests that the market might be oversold, with continued downward pressure expected. The sustained stay in this area points to a potential continuation of the bearish trend unless a reversal occurs, making it a crucial point for market participants to consider for ITI.
Parabolic SAR: The PSAR maintains a bearish outlook for ITI, establishing a key resistance level that could limit further gains. This ongoing bearish trend suggests that the market may struggle to overcome this resistance, keeping upward movement subdued.
Stochastic: The stochastic indicator reflects a bullish outlook with the K-line above the D-line and below 20, signaling the likely start of a bullish move. This setup suggests that the market may be beginning to rise from a low level, potentially leading to an uptrend. Traders might interpret this as a positive entry signal.
Tripple Moving Agerage: A bullish trend for ITI Limited is reflected in the alignment of the 20-50-100 period moving averages, though the slopes of the faster averages raise concerns about a potential reversal. The weakening momentum in the shorter-term averages suggests that the current trend may not last, signaling the possibility of a shift in direction.
